- Lägler completely migrates to Debian GNU/Linux
- Linux is becoming more and more popular in the business world and in the public sector. Companies are under increasing pressure to cut back costs and Linux is the cost-effective alternative to Microsoft products. What the city of Munich is presently implementing has already been achieved at the long-established company Eugen Lägler GmbH & Co., located in the Swabian town of Güglingen. The entire company IT, including the ERP system they used, was changed over to Debian GNU/Linux.
- More than 80% of abas installations are based on Linux
- ABAS Software AG is a forerunner as far as standard business management software on Linux is concerned. Since 1995, the Karlsruher have been delivering their business software on the Linux server operating systems. By now approximately 80% of the over 1,900 abas installations in medium sized companies use the Open Source System. The customers benefit from the experience headstart of ABAS.
